What is EMC Testing?

EMC testing is a process designed to measure a device’s immunity to electromagnetic disturbances and its emissions of electromagnetic radiation. These disturbances can come from natural sources, such as lightning, or from other electronic devices, including mobile phones, motors, or power lines. The goal is twofold:

  1. Emission Testing – Ensuring the device does not emit excessive electromagnetic interference that could disrupt other devices.

  2. Immunity Testing – Confirming the device continues to operate correctly even when exposed to electromagnetic disturbances.

Without proper EMC testing, electronic devices may fail in real-world conditions, leading to product recalls, customer dissatisfaction, and regulatory penalties.

Types of EMC Testing

EMC testing typically falls into several categories:

  1. Radiated Emissions Testing
    Measures electromagnetic energy emitted from a device into the surrounding environment. Testing is usually performed in a specialized chamber called an anechoic chamber.

  2. Conducted Emissions Testing
    Assesses electromagnetic energy conducted along cables, such as power cords, which could interfere with other connected equipment.

  3. Radiated Immunity Testing
    Evaluates a device’s resistance to external electromagnetic fields, ensuring normal operation under realistic interference scenarios.

  4. Conducted Immunity Testing
    Tests device performance when subjected to electromagnetic disturbances conducted through cables and wiring.

  5. Electrostatic Discharge (ESD) Testing
    Simulates static electricity shocks to ensure the device can withstand sudden surges without damage.

  6. Surge and Transient Testing
    Evaluates protection against voltage spikes and lightning surges, which are common in power systems.

EMC Testing Standards

Compliance with international standards is essential for EMC certification. Some of the widely recognized standards include:

  • IEC 61000 series – International Electrotechnical Commission standards covering emission and immunity requirements.

  • CISPR 11/22/32 – Standards for industrial, scientific, and medical equipment emissions.

  • FCC Part 15 – United States regulation governing electromagnetic interference from electronic devices.

  • EN 55032 – European standard for multimedia equipment emissions.

Adherence to these standards ensures that products can safely coexist with other electronic devices worldwide.

EMC Testing Process

The EMC testing process generally involves several steps:

  1. Pre-Compliance Testing – Early-stage testing to identify and mitigate EMC issues before formal certification.

  2. Test Planning – Selection of test types, standards, and environmental conditions.

  3. Test Execution – Conducted in controlled environments using specialized equipment such as spectrum analyzers, antennas, and probes.

  4. Analysis and Reporting – Test results are compared against regulatory limits, and detailed reports are prepared.

  5. Remediation – If a product fails, design modifications are implemented to reduce emissions or improve immunity, followed by retesting.
